銀彈谷:低程式碼點亮普惠數字化轉型之路

我的程式碼歲月發表於2022-04-26

低程式碼基於底層技術能力,將開發模組抽象編排實現敏捷開發 

低程式碼通常是指aPaaS產品,通過為開發者提供視覺化的應用開發環境,降低或去除應用開發對原生程式碼編寫的需求量, 進而實現便捷構建應用程式的一種解決方案。因此,低程式碼平臺也常被稱為aPaaS平臺。 

低程式碼基於底層容器、微服務、資料庫、中介軟體等PaaS層能力,向上進行應用模組的抽象,通過UI編排、流程編排、 業務編排等實現應用產品的開發。 

通過開發API介面,低程式碼可以實現企業應用過程中的二次開發,增加產品的可擴充套件性和靈活性。 

低程式碼產品可以入駐第三方聚合平臺,通過第三方聚合平臺的生態共建,實現供給側和需求側資源的快速對接,低程式碼 平臺能力的擴充,應用場景的豐富化搭建。 


零程式碼使用門檻低,低程式碼可搭建複雜度較高的應用 

按搭建應用時是否需要程式碼可以將廣義低程式碼產品分為狹義低程式碼和零程式碼兩種,二者均可通過視覺化介面,對封裝好的程式碼模組進行拖拉拽來完成應用搭建。其中低程式碼主要服務關注業務邏輯的開發部門,需要少量程式碼進行模組銜接或功能 擴充;零程式碼更強調低程式碼的低門檻,僅需理順業務邏輯即可快速搭建流程管理、表單等輕量級應用。整體上看,低程式碼產品的函式與系統解耦,在少量程式碼的支援下應用場景較廣,而零程式碼輕量便捷,搭建速度快,賦予業務部門更多自主權。


從搭建流程型應用向挖掘資料價值遞進,演化出三種形態

按照低程式碼產品的底層驅動技術可劃分為表單驅動、邏輯驅動和資料驅動三類。表單驅動直接關注業務場景,以資料表為核心、以工作流為媒介構建應用。模型驅動從業務場景中抽象出模型構建頁面和業務流,其應用場景更加複雜且廣泛。資料驅動在模型驅動的基礎上深度挖掘資料價值,將從網際網路及其他軟體收集來的資料進行彙總和整理,運用新技術和演算法 訓練擬合成自動化決策模型。整體上看,低程式碼正從基礎表單向資料驅動遞進,其功能性逐漸提升,覆蓋更多業務場景。


通用型低程式碼普適性強,垂直型專注於細分場景產品的打磨 

按照低程式碼產品的應用場景可將其劃分為通用型和垂直型。通用型低程式碼產品覆蓋各行業各場景,有多種行業模板和解決方案可供使用者挑選。垂直型低程式碼產品深耕特定行業或特定場景,針對不同行業屬性和場景特點提供專業性高的模板和解決方案。目前市場上通用型和垂直型低程式碼廠商業務相互滲透:通用型廠商的業務逐漸深入並發展出行業特色;垂直型廠商也在拓寬業務邊界,逐漸擴充套件產品能力圈。


縮減軟體開發成本和人力成本,大幅提高人效價值 

低程式碼主要從軟體開發費用和人力支出兩個角度降低總開發成本。從軟體開發費用上看,低程式碼平臺可以按年和使用人數 進行訂閱制付費,開發者在平臺上自行呼叫元件開發應用;也可以按需定製,廠商根據應用的複雜程度差異化定價,兩種模式的成本支出均優於傳統軟體開發。從人力支出上看,我國軟體從業人員薪資不斷遞增,而低程式碼調動企業對業務人員的需求,通過技術賦能開發提升人工效能,均衡企業對高中低端開發人員的薪資支出比例。此外,企業運用低程式碼縮短軟 件試錯時間和整體開發時間,降低整體機會成本,讓企業有更多時間和資金投身於行業業務新動態的捕捉。


開箱即用降低軟體開發門檻,普惠支援企業數字化升級 

從應用場景上看,目前低程式碼已覆蓋小程式、ESB、BPM、DevOps等場景,開發人員以低程式碼的技術底座和API介面為基 礎,僅需輕量二次開發即可實現內部系統聯通,全面降低軟體開發難度。從應用開發方式上看,低程式碼開發平臺以視覺化 介面和拖拉拽的應用搭建方式賦能開發者和業務人員,並通過抽象和封裝的程式碼降低開發人員的程式碼准入門檻,契合中小 企業應用開發靈活性需求,推進中小企業數字化程式。從應用低程式碼企業數量上看,氚雲、簡道雲、維格表、輕流等知名 低程式碼廠商均通過低程式碼賦能萬餘家企業,並通過聚合平臺不斷推進企業技術創新和數字化升級。隨著低程式碼的普及和場 景滲透加深,未來低程式碼將整合更多技術,賦能各行業企業的複雜場景需求,向技術中臺和應用中臺的方向演進。


基於模板快速開發,敏捷響應需求提升產品個性化應用 

低程式碼開發平臺為開發者提供海量模板、應用和解決方案,覆蓋垂直行業和通用業務場景,全方位滿足企業應用搭建的個 性化需求。開發者基於應用模板和視覺化介面進行二次開發,搭建業務邏輯簡單的基礎應用和初級業務系統平均僅需1周, 搭建業務邏輯較複雜的初級工業系統僅需1-2周,大幅縮短開發時間。據調研,100人的研發團隊通過低程式碼開發應用,平 均1年縮短應用開發時間92天。此外,低程式碼平臺的業務屬性擊穿了業務部門和研發部門的溝通隔斷,降低資訊傳達的時 間消耗,提高開發敏捷性和成功率,整體縮短了開發週期。


低程式碼聚合平臺是重要轉折階段,加快行業生態資料打通

從廠商產品形態和行業發展特徵來看,低程式碼行業的進階大致可以分為4個階段,從早期的軟體開發工具複用再到低程式碼 平臺型產品的入局,低程式碼行業底層技術架構進行了重大突破,從原來的傳統架構向更為靈活敏捷的雲原生架構演進,為 低程式碼平臺的搭建提供了技術支撐。當前階段,隨著釘釘搭以聚合平臺的形式出現在大眾視野,顛覆了以往市場對於低代 碼行業的想象,越來越多的低程式碼廠商入駐聚合平臺,進行能力的開放和合作的互通,形成以聚合平臺為中心,低程式碼廠 商圍繞的生態圈。當然,生態的發展必然會帶來對資料壁壘打通的訴求,未來,在聚合平臺的技術和合作支援下,將會進 一步加快生態資料的互聯互通。 


相對垂直型軟體,低程式碼平臺的行業屬性相對較弱,但是由於各行業需求痛點和轉型路徑不同,低程式碼平臺在各行業的滲 透率有所差異。從當前行業滲透現狀來看,製造業、泛網際網路、教育等勞動力密集的行業滲透率相對較高,其中製造業在 我國十四五規劃中“先進製造”的目標推進下,加快工業網際網路建設,對供給端的生產效率、產品質量、敏捷反應等提出 了更高的要求。低程式碼的應用能夠顯著改善生產過程,明顯提升企業數字化運營的靈活性,預計製造業中低程式碼應用滲透 率在20%左右。 


作為全棧式、零程式碼開發平臺服務商,銀彈谷以專注軟體工程專案賦能與研發生產力改善、推動行業與生態進度為使命,面對數字經濟蓬勃發展始終保持精研零程式碼開發技術的初心,鑄就V-DevSuite銀彈谷零程式碼軟體開發套件科技核芯。


詳情請檢視報告,文章主要資訊來源《艾瑞諮詢:2022年中國低程式碼行業生態發展洞察報告》。


來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69982242/viewspace-2888820/,如需轉載,請註明出處,否則將追究法律責任。

相關文章